2005 Chevrolet Avalanche vs. 1989 Plymouth Voyager

To start off, 2005 Chevrolet Avalanche is newer by 16 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Plymouth Voyager.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Plymouth Voyager would be higher. At 5,325 cc (8 cylinders), 2005 Chevrolet Avalanche is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Chevrolet Avalanche weights approximately 1117 kg more than 1989 Plymouth Voyager.
